Choosing Quality Wholesale CBD Edibles
Key Factors to Consider
When selecting wholesale CBD edibles, several factors should be considered to ensure high quality and consumer satisfaction. First and foremost, the source of the CBD is critical. Products derived from organic hemp without the use of harmful pesticides or chemicals are preferable. Additionally, the extraction method used to obtain CBD can significantly affect its purity and potency; CO2 extraction is often considered the gold standard.
Other factors include the dosage per serving, the presence of other beneficial cannabinoids or terpenes, and the overall flavor profile of the edibles. Lastly, consumer preferences anticipated through market research can guide retailers in selecting the right products to meet demand.
Lab Testing and Certifications
Independent lab testing is vital for ensuring the safety and efficacy of wholesale CBD edibles. Reputable manufacturers will provide Certificates of Analysis (COAs) that confirm the product’s cannabinoid profile and verify the absence of contaminants, such as heavy metals, molds, and solvents. When selecting wholesale products, businesses should only partner with suppliers who are transparent about their testing practices and can provide third-party lab results upon request. This not only assures quality but helps build trust with end consumers.

Potential Challenges in the CBD Edibles Market
Regulatory Compliance
CBD regulations are continually evolving, which presents a challenge for businesses operating in this space. It is imperative for retailers to stay updated on local, state, and federal regulations regarding the sale of CBD products. Compliance includes ensuring proper product labeling, marketing practices, and adherence to restrictions on THC levels.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in penalties, product recalls, or even the shutdown of business operations.
Addressing Misconceptions about CBD
Despite the growth of the industry, numerous misconceptions about CBD still exist. Many consumers associate CBD with the psychoactive effects of THC, creating hesitance surrounding its use. Education is key to overcoming these barriers; businesses should prioritize clarifying how CBD differs from THC, emphasizing that CBD does not produce a “high.” Providing consumers with clear, research-backed information can help establish trust and interest in the products.
